Purpose: The purpose of this project is to apply the concepts of sequences and senes to another topic of mathematics, fractals. Fractal: a fractal is a geometric shape that can be split in parts that are reduced scale pattems of the original. This pattem is repeated an innite number of tima. If you zoom in on any part of it you will see it looks the same. One such fractal is the Sierpinski Triangle. This fraotal is created by connech'ng the midpoint: of the three side; of an equilateral triangle. This create a new equilateral triangle which is then \"remoyed" from the original. The remaining three triangle are smaller versions of our original. This procas can then be repeated to continue to create other iterations of the gure.
